hitspin[.]casino
“Hitspin | Decentralized Web3 Gambling Site with Provable Trust”
The domain hitspin.casino is currently associated with high-risk brand impersonation, specifically targeting the crypto casino and gambling sector. The site presents itself under the name 'Hitspin | Decentralized Web3 Gambling Site with Provable Trust,' mimicking legitimate decentralized casino platforms. The impersonation raises significant concerns about potential fraudulent activities, such as credential harvesting or cryptocurrency theft, though there is currently no direct evidence of a drainer kit present on the site.
Technical analysis shows that hitspin.casino resolves to the IP address 104.21.53.43. VirusTotal intelligence indicates that 4 out of 95 security vendors have flagged this domain for malicious activity, corroborating its risk profile. The domain remains active and accessible at the time of analysis. The page title and branding closely align with legitimate crypto gambling offerings, increasing the likelihood of deceiving end users. Information regarding the registrar, creation date, Google Safe Browsing status, and blocklist counts was not available in the provided dataset and should be gathered for a more comprehensive assessment.
Given its current active status and the presence of multiple security vendor detections, hitspin.casino poses a substantial risk to users—especially those seeking decentralized gambling services. It is recommended to block access to this domain across enterprise and personal networks, monitor for any user attempts to interact with the site, and educate stakeholders about the risks of engaging with unverified crypto gambling platforms. Ongoing vigilance for further malicious infrastructure or updates to its threat status is advised, as the domain remains live and unmitigated.
